Deputy PM named Turkmenistan's interim president
ALMATY, Dec. 21 (Xinhua) -- Turkmenistan's Deputy Prime Minister Gurbanguly Berdymukhamedov has been named interim president after the death of Saparmurat Niyazov early Thursday, the country's national security council announced.
Bush expresses sadness over Turkmenistan president's death
WASHINGTON, Dec. 21 (Xinhua) -- U.S. President George W. Bush expressed his sadness over the death of Turkmenistan President Saparmurat Niyazov, National Security Council spokesman Gordon Johndroe said Thursday.
Russia hopes for orderly succession of power in Turkmenistan
MOSCOW, Dec. 21 (Xinhua) -- Russia hopes for a legal succession of power in Turkmenistan following the demise of Saparmurat Niyazov, president of Turkmenistan, who died on Thursday at the age of 66,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ov said.
EU hopes for smooth succession in Turkmenistan after president's sudden death
BRUSSELS, Dec. 21 (Xinhua) -- The European Commission expressed the hope on Thursday that the succession process in Turkmenistan would be orderly after the sudden death of President Saparmurat Niyazov.
Annan pays tribute to Turkmenistan's President Niyazov
UNITED NATIONS, Dec. 21 (Xinhua) -- UN Secretary-General Kofi Annan on Thursday extended condolences to the people of Turkmenistan on the death of President Saparmurat Niyazov and paid tribute to his contribution to UN peace efforts in Tajikistan and Afghanistan.
